Lot Description
A George III silver mounted toddy ladle, the spouted bowl leading to the part-twisted baleen stem having foliate engraved mounted collar. Hallmarked London with the maker's mark T.M. Length measures 15 4/8 inches (39.5 cm).

Condition Report
In poor condition with area of damage and repair to bowl at base of stem. Bowl also with distortion, multiple dents and heavy tarnishing. Hallmarks heavily worn and rubbed and so partly illegible with no date letter visible.
